Analysis

Spain recorded 492,207 for population, age 6, total in 2015.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.

That represents a change of up 1.2% on the previous year and up 24.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population, age 6, total in Spain peaked at 492,207 in 2015 and was at its lowest, 383,869, in 2001.

Spain ranks 54th of 191 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
